Electronic Health Record Transition and Impact on Screening Test Follow-Up.
Electronic health record (EHR) transitions improved prostate-specific antigen (PSA) test follow-up, reversing a prior decline. However, EHR transitions did not significantly impact follow-up rates for incidental pulmonary nodules or Pap smears.
Area of Science:
- Medical Informatics
- Health Services Research
- Clinical Diagnostics
Background:
- Nonurgent clinically significant test results (CSTRs) are a frequent source of diagnostic delays.
- The impact of electronic health record (EHR) transitions on CSTR follow-up remains understudied.
Purpose of the Study:
- To investigate the effect of an EHR transition on follow-up rates for three specific CSTRs: incidental pulmonary nodules (IPNs), prostate-specific antigen (PSA) tests, and Pap smears.
Main Methods:
- Retrospective cohort study utilizing an interrupted time series (ITS) design.
- Assessed monthly follow-up rates for IPNs, PSA tests, and Pap smears before and after EHR transition at an urban tertiary medical center.
- Defined follow-up based on specific clinical actions within defined timeframes for each test type.
Main Results:
- No significant changes in follow-up rates were observed for IPNs or Pap smears post-EHR transition.
- A significant decreasing trend in PSA test follow-up was identified in the pre-EHR transition period.
- The EHR transition significantly altered the trend for PSA test follow-up, reversing the pre-existing decline.
Conclusions:
- EHR transitions can positively influence the follow-up of specific CSTRs, such as PSA tests, by mitigating declining trends.
- The impact of EHR transitions on CSTR follow-up may vary depending on the specific type of test evaluated.
- Further research is needed to understand the differential effects of EHR implementations on clinical test result management.
